首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

关键字“BuiltIn.Log To Console”应为1到3个参数,实际为8

关键字“BuiltIn.Log To Console”是一个用于在云计算领域中进行日志记录的功能。它通常用于将信息输出到控制台,以便开发人员进行调试和错误排查。

该关键字应为1到3个参数,但实际上有8个参数。这可能是一个错误或者误解。以下是对该关键字的解释和可能的参数:

  1. 概念:BuiltIn.Log To Console是一个内置的日志记录功能,用于在开发过程中输出信息到控制台。
  2. 分类:该功能属于日志记录和调试工具的范畴。
  3. 优势:使用BuiltIn.Log To Console可以方便地输出调试信息,帮助开发人员快速定位和解决问题。
  4. 应用场景:该功能适用于各种云计算应用场景,包括前端开发、后端开发、移动开发等。
  5. 推荐的腾讯云相关产品:腾讯云提供了一系列与日志记录和调试相关的产品和服务,例如腾讯云日志服务(CLS),可以帮助用户实现更高级的日志管理和分析功能。您可以访问腾讯云日志服务的官方介绍页面了解更多信息:腾讯云日志服务介绍

请注意,以上答案仅供参考,具体的参数和用法可能因实际情况而异。建议在实际开发中参考相关文档和官方指南,以确保正确使用该功能。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

C#委托与事件

public delegate int MyDelegate (string s); //声明一个全局的委托,参数string类型 方法名作为参数 ----   委托是一个类,它定义了方法的类型,使得可以将方法当作另一个方法的参数来进行传递...当创建委托时,传递 new 语句的参数就像方法调用一样书写,但是不带有参数。...} } 将方法绑定委托 ----   可以将多个方法赋给同一个委托,或者叫将多个方法绑定同一个委托,当调用这个委托的时候,将依次调用其所绑定的方法。...事件声明 ----   事件和方法一样具有签名,签名包括名称和参数列表。事件的签名通过委托类型来定义,然后向类中添加事件需要使用 event 关键字,并提供委托类型和事件名称。...用event关键字定义事件对象,它同时也是一个delegate对象。 用+=操作符添加事件事件队列中(-=操作符能够将事件从队列中删除)。

99660

C# lambda表达式

匿名方法的优点: a、减少了要编写的代码,不必定义由委托使用的方法 b、降低了代码的复杂度,尤其是定义了好几个事件时 但是,匿名方法的代码执行速度并没有加快,应为编译器还是会生成一个方法,所以使用匿名方法...(func(2, 3)); Console.ReadLine(); } } 当Lamdba表达式方法体只有一行代码时,就不需要中括号,和return关键字...(func(2, 3)); Console.ReadLine(); } } 但是如果有多行代码就必须加中括号和return关键字了,有点类似与if else...(func(1) + "...." + func(2)); Console.ReadLine(); } } 输出:8和9并不是我们想的7和8, 原因在编译器处理外部变量的方式...:对于lamdba表达式x=>x+value1,编译器会创建一个类,它有一个构造函数来初始化外部参数, 该构造函数的参数个数值取决于外部传递进来的参数个数,代码如下: public class

61660

实例对比剖析c#引用参数的用法建议收藏

大家好,又见面了,我是全栈君 c#引用参数传递的深入剖析值类型的变量存储数据,而引用类型的变量存储对实际数据的引用。...13 F(a);//调用函数F,注意:这时将对象a的引用(不是对象a)赋值给参数a1, 14 Console.WriteLine(a.data); } } 这是一个直接传递的例子...:ref 关键字使参数按引用传递。...其效果是,当控制权传递回调用方法时,在方法中对参数所做的任何更改都将反映在该变量中。若要使用 ref 参数,则方法定义和调用方法都必须显式使用 ref 关键字。...:这时将对象a的引用传给a1,不是赋值,相当与 给a对象的引用起了个别名 12 Console.WriteLine(a.data);//这时a已经指向函数中新建的对象,因此值应为

54830

C#3.0新增功能04 扩展方法

对于用 C#、F# 和 Visual Basic 编写的客户端代码,调用扩展方法与调用在类型中实际定义的方法没有明显区别。...// 扩展方法必须定义在静态类的内部 8 public static class StringExtension 9 { 10 // 这是一个扩展方法:第一个参数必须使用...注意,第一个参数不是由调用代码指定的 28 System.Console.WriteLine("Word count of s is {0}", i); 29 }...实际上,扩展方法无法访问它们所扩展的类型中的私有变量。 通常,你更多时候是调用扩展方法而不是实现你自己的扩展方法。...如果未找到任何匹配方法,编译器将搜索该类型定义的任何扩展方法,并且绑定它找到的第一个扩展方法。 下面的示例演示编译器如何确定要绑定哪个扩展方法或实例方法。

48020

事件(Event)

代理(delegate) delegate是c#中的一种类型,它实际上是一个能够持有对某个方法的引用的类。...实现一个delegate是很简单的,通过以下3个步骤即可实现一个delegate: 1. 声明一个delegate对象,它应当与你想要传递的方法具有相同的参数和返回值类型。 2....结合delegate的实现,我们可以将自定义事件的实现归结为以下几步: 1:定义delegate对象类型,它有两个参数,第一个参数是事件发送者对象,第二个参数是事件参数类对象。...4:用event关键字定义事件对象,它同时也是一个delegate对象。 5:用+=操作符添加事件事件队列中(-=操作符能够将事件从队列中删除)。...一般来说,此方法应为protected访问限制,既不能以public方式调用,但可以被子类继承。名字是可以是OnEventName。 7:在适当的地方调用事件触发方法触发事件。

98820

C# this关键字(给底层类库扩展成员方法)

本文参考自唔愛吃蘋果的C#原始类型扩展方法—this参数修饰符,并在其基础上做了一些细节上的解释 1、this作为参数关键字的作用 使用this关键字,可以向this关键字后面的类型添加扩展方法,而无需给其创建新的派生类型...但是this关键字最主要的作用是对类型的重载方法的扩充,来满足自身的需求,因为有些类方法的重载方法可能不是很完善,而直接修改类型的条件不足(应为可能有些已经被编译成dll,有些测试.net框架的底层类)...而且静态类中不能有成员变量,this关键字是个列外 (3)、当类是静态类时,程序会在编译的时候,就将所有的静态成员编译全局环境中,当类不是静态类的时候,只有当类中的静态成员被调用之后,才会被初始化全局环境中...这样是调不到FormatWith方法的,应为此时的FormatWith方法还没有被初始化,所以编译器会报错 ?...ok,说明实例方法扩展成功 总结:上面的扩展方法的调用方式,看上去像是成员方法,但实际编译器会对this关键字做特殊处理,编译器生成的中间语言(IL)会将代码转换为对静态方法的调用, 因此,并未真正违反封装原则

1.1K70

关键字

1、int?  关键字说明 (1)、int? 表示一个int类型,且该int类型可空,如果不加?...aa = 1; Console.WriteLine(aa ?? 0); } 输出: 2、?...结构将支持值类型扩展成可空类型,但是不支持引用类型,应为它们原本就是可空类型 3、可空类型具有以下特征 (1)、可空类型表示可被赋值 null 值的值类型变量。无法创建基于引用类型的可空类型。...True;或者,如果此变量的值空,则返回 False (7)、如果已赋值,则 Value 属性返回该值,否则将引发 System.InvalidOperationException (8)、可空类型变量的默认值将...运算符分配默认值,当前值空的可空类型被赋值给非空类型时将应用该默认值,如 int? x = null; int y = x ?? -1; (10)、不允许使用嵌套的可空类型。

939100

python自定义函数def的应用详解

range(10): print(i) 结果: 0 1 2 3 4 5 6 7 8 9 for i in range(10): print(i,end= ' ')...结果: 0 1 2 3 4 5 6 7 8 9 默认参数 在函数涉及过程中很多参数不一定所有人一定用的上,可以设置一个默认值,这样子需要的人可以DIY,没有需要的就采用默认参数 比如print(...)中 end 就是默认参数默认值‘\n’ def add(x=0, y=0): return x+y print(add()) 结果: 0 必选参数 必选参数就是必须要写的参数,这个与默认参数相对...所有在使用函数及自定义时要注意必选参数的设置 可变参数 可变参数这个名字比较高大上,但是实际上很简单 比如要写一个多个数字相加的函数怎么办呢? 直接写?...会应为多了一个参数报错 那么就改成三个参数

2.2K10

1天--文本与变量

; 创建控制台程序并将上面的代码赋值 main 方法中,运行程序你将会看到如下的输出: 2. char char 读作 ***[tʃɑbaiː]***,在 C# 中 char 类型的数据只能包含一个字符...H'); Console.WriteLine('こ'); 运行上述代码得到如下输出: Tip:这里要注意的是 string 使用的是英文状态下的双信号,char 使用的是应为状态的下的单引号,初学者容易在这里出现错误...上一小节我们所编写的代码都是硬编码,但是在实际开发中使用硬编码的情况少之又少,因此我们就需要用到变量这一结构。...隐式类型使用 var 关键字声明。...序号 规则 1 可包含字母、数字、字符以及下划线字符 2 必须以字母或下划线开头,不能以数字开头 3 不能是 C# 关键字 4 区分大小写,age 和 Age 是两个变量 5 建议使用驼峰命名法,即第一个单词的首字母以小写开始

69200

我不知道的前端(一)

我尝试了一下 var array=[-1,1,3,4,6,10]; array.sort((a,b)=>{console.log(a,b);return a-b;}); 1 -1 3 1 4 3 6...4 10 6 第一个参数,即a,array[1,array.length-1],第二个结尾 第二个参数,即b,array[0,array.length-2],第一个倒数第二个 a-b的通意即后一项减前一项的值...|4-3|=3-1>0==>[3,4,6,1,-1] |10-3|-|6-3|=7-3=4>0==>[3,4,6,10,1,-1] 所以结果应为[3,4,6,10,1,-1] 另外注意,sort是排序原本的数组...该参数可以是数字,使用的是要访问的 URL 在 History 的 URL 列表中的相对位置。(-1上一个页面,1前进一个页面)。...3、当用apply和call上下文调用的时候指向传入的第一个参数 4、构造函数调用指向实例对象 JS中this关键字, 它代表函数运行时,自动生成的一个内部对象,只能在函数内部使用 全局函数调用时

54810

C# new关键字和对象类型转换(双括号、is操作符、as操作符)

一、new关键字 CLR要求所有的对象都通过new来创建,代码如下: Object obj=new Object(); 以下是new操作符做的事情 1、计算类型及其所有基类型(一直到System.Object...注:没有和new操作符对应的delete操作符,换言之,没有办法显示释放对象分配的内存.CLR采用了垃圾回收机制,能自动检测到一个对象不在被使用或者访问,并自动释放对象的内存....但是,日常开发中,经常需要将一种类型转换成另一种类型,CLR允许将对象转换成其实际类型或者它的任何基类型.每种编程语言都规定了开发人员具体如何进行这种转换.C#不要求任何特殊语法即可将对象转换成它的基类型...是否兼容于Person类型,如果是,在if语句内部转型时,CLR再次核实stu是否引用一个Person类型,CLR的类型检查增强了安全性,但无疑会对性能造成一定的影响,应为CLR首先必须去判断变量引用的实际类型...操作符的做法,同时提供is操作符的性能,C#专门提供了as操作符,as操作符的工作方式与强制类型转换一样,只是它永远不抛出异常,如果对象不能转换,结果就是null.所以正确使用as操作符的做法是检查转型结果是否null

93990

前端day11-JS学习笔记(构造函数、对象的API、作用域、arguments关键字)

:本地版本 console.log ( date.toLocaleTimeString () );//下午8:51:17 /*年月日时打印*/ //1.打印当前年份 console.log... 如果负数则倒着查找 //第二个参数: end : 结束位置    start <= 范围 < end console.log(arr1.slice(1, 3)); //[20, 70] //8...(sortarr);//从小到大排序 console.log(sortarr.reverse());//从小到大翻转一下就变成从大小 2.3String字符串对象 /* ## String...,实际上在调用的时候无论我们传入多少实参程序都不会报错 为了防止这种情况:函数有一个arguments关键字来获取所有的实参 3.arguments特点 1.只能在函数体中使用,在函数外使用会报错 2....} fn(10, 20); //实参与形参一一对应 /** 二:arguments实际用途展示:根据参数的数量让函数实现不同的功能 */

81410
领券